ExcelScript.ShapeFont interface
Représente les attributs de police, tels que le nom de la police, la taille de police et la couleur, pour l’objet d’une TextRange
forme.
Remarques
Exemples
/**
* This sample sets the font of a shape to be bold.
*/
function main(workbook: ExcelScript.Workbook) {
// Get the first shape in the current worksheet.
const sheet = workbook.getActiveWorksheet();
const shape = sheet.getShapes()[0];
// Get the text font from the shape.
const text: ExcelScript.TextRange = shape.getTextFrame().getTextRange();
const shapeTextFont: ExcelScript.ShapeFont = text.getFont();
// Set the font to be bold.
shapeTextFont.setBold(true);
}
Méthodes
get |
Représente le format de police Gras. Retourne |
get |
Représentation par code de couleur HTML de la couleur du texte (par exemple, « #FF0000 » représente le rouge). Retourne |
get |
Représente le format de police Italique. Retourne |
get |
Représente le nom de la police (par exemple, « Calibri »). Si le texte est un script complexe ou une langue d’Asie de l’Est, il s’agit du nom de police correspondant ; sinon, il s’agit du nom de la police latine. |
get |
Représente la taille de police en points (par exemple, 11). Retourne |
get |
Type de soulignement appliqué à la police. Retourne |
set |
Représente le format de police Gras. Retourne |
set |
Représentation par code de couleur HTML de la couleur du texte (par exemple, « #FF0000 » représente le rouge). Retourne |
set |
Représente le format de police Italique. Retourne |
set |
Représente le nom de la police (par exemple, « Calibri »). Si le texte est un script complexe ou une langue d’Asie de l’Est, il s’agit du nom de police correspondant ; sinon, il s’agit du nom de la police latine. |
set |
Représente la taille de police en points (par exemple, 11). Retourne |
set |
Type de soulignement appliqué à la police. Retourne |
Détails de la méthode
getBold()
Représente le format de police Gras. Retourne null
si inclut des TextRange
fragments de texte en gras et non gras.
getBold(): boolean;
Retours
boolean
getColor()
Représentation par code de couleur HTML de la couleur du texte (par exemple, « #FF0000 » représente le rouge). Retourne null
si inclut des TextRange
fragments de texte de couleurs différentes.
getColor(): string;
Retours
string
getItalic()
Représente le format de police Italique. Retourne null
si inclut des TextRange
fragments de texte italique et non italique.
getItalic(): boolean;
Retours
boolean
getName()
Représente le nom de la police (par exemple, « Calibri »). Si le texte est un script complexe ou une langue d’Asie de l’Est, il s’agit du nom de police correspondant ; sinon, il s’agit du nom de la police latine.
getName(): string;
Retours
string
getSize()
Représente la taille de police en points (par exemple, 11). Retourne null
si inclut des TextRange
fragments de texte avec des tailles de police différentes.
getSize(): number;
Retours
number
getUnderline()
Type de soulignement appliqué à la police. Retourne null
si inclut des fragments de TextRange
texte avec différents styles de soulignement. Pour plus d’informations, consultez ExcelScript.ShapeFontUnderlineStyle
.
getUnderline(): ShapeFontUnderlineStyle;
Retours
setBold(bold)
Représente le format de police Gras. Retourne null
si inclut des TextRange
fragments de texte en gras et non gras.
setBold(bold: boolean): void;
Paramètres
- bold
-
boolean
Retours
void
setColor(color)
Représentation par code de couleur HTML de la couleur du texte (par exemple, « #FF0000 » représente le rouge). Retourne null
si inclut des TextRange
fragments de texte de couleurs différentes.
setColor(color: string): void;
Paramètres
- color
-
string
Retours
void
setItalic(italic)
Représente le format de police Italique. Retourne null
si inclut des TextRange
fragments de texte italique et non italique.
setItalic(italic: boolean): void;
Paramètres
- italic
-
boolean
Retours
void
setName(name)
Représente le nom de la police (par exemple, « Calibri »). Si le texte est un script complexe ou une langue d’Asie de l’Est, il s’agit du nom de police correspondant ; sinon, il s’agit du nom de la police latine.
setName(name: string): void;
Paramètres
- name
-
string
Retours
void
setSize(size)
Représente la taille de police en points (par exemple, 11). Retourne null
si inclut des TextRange
fragments de texte avec des tailles de police différentes.
setSize(size: number): void;
Paramètres
- size
-
number
Retours
void
setUnderline(underline)
Type de soulignement appliqué à la police. Retourne null
si inclut des fragments de TextRange
texte avec différents styles de soulignement. Pour plus d’informations, consultez ExcelScript.ShapeFontUnderlineStyle
.
setUnderline(underline: ShapeFontUnderlineStyle): void;
Paramètres
- underline
- ExcelScript.ShapeFontUnderlineStyle
Retours
void